Summary

Oil painting on canvas, General the Hon. Sir Galbraith Lowry Cole GCB (1772 -1842) (copy after Lawrence) by William Robinson (Leeds 1799 - Leeds 1839). A half-length portrait in uniform, after a portrait by Lawrence, present whereabouts unknown. Sir Galbraith was the younger son of the 1st Earl of Inniskillen. He was Governor of Mauritius (1823-8), and of Cape Colony, 1828-33. He was knighted in 1813. He wears the star of the Bath, which must have been added after 1813.
